Keets is a kind-hearted young man who is an old soul in many ways. He loves birds and gryphons of every kind. A few times a week he checks to make sure the bird feeders at the Keep are full and that there is clean water in the bird baths. The squirrels and mice that come out to inquire for seeds in the garden are never disappointed, he always saves a few handfuls for them. (Don't worry, the gryphons are far too well-fed to pose a threat to the little cuties.) A few of the gryph's are pets and sleep in the rookery. He says quills from friends make the best kind. He's given to flights of fancy and words are his best friend. He loves them. The way they twine and join and become beauty in endless dancing fashions. He's seen hard times but that only seems to give his words more passion as if he knows that life is short and one must blur the lines between what might be and what is. He is a poet and is never seen without his homemade quills and scraps of paper tucked into his pockets.
Likes: His family, books, reading, being outdoors, and has a small army of Griffin pets and birds.

After moving to a cottage in the woods in order to get some writing inspiration Keets wandered near the Keep one day and happened to meet the mysterious Violla. He finds her mesmerizing and loves to just be in her presence. Violla found him to be naive and a little young for her. She's a woodland spirit who tends to the seasons and vegetation in the area. However, the more time she spent around him, the more fond of him she became. Begrudgingly, (at first), she fell for his sweet nature and big heart. He adores her more than anything under the sun and when they finally fall in love it's the best thing that's ever happened to either of them.
They live in the woods on the outskirts of a land owned by a magic user named Iridestra. The children aren't allowed near the old castle, called The Keep, but Keets likes to visit with Bespelled. They both enjoy writing and often exchange books with one another. He also tends to the birds that flock to the Keeps beautiful gardens. Violla tends to avoid it when Iridestra is around, the sorceress wasn't thrilled that the the earth spirit wanted to keep her job instead of relocating to another part of the land. But she still comes in and makes sure everything is growing and healthy.
Violla is a vital part of the environment and brings forth the spring and keeps the summer going. In the fall she turns brown and begins to tire and goes to sleep earlier, bringing the sunsets down upon the world a little faster. Winter is a time for hibernation and fun in the snow. With Bespelled's magic she's able to stay awake longer during the long dark winters, and not affect the season. Every night Keets snuggles up to her and is rewarded with a purr from deep within her dreams. His sleeping fox means more than words can say.
They have 3 children. two of them are twins- Mullberry and Maebel, and they also have one toddler named Sweetpeas. Keets is a wonderful father and enjoys coming up with his own stories to tell them. Most of his favorite moments are right before bedtime when the whole family is all cuddled up under the covers nice and warm, with his beautiful lady beside him and his children drowsing off to their dreams as he spins tales of beautiful adventures and lullabyes.
Profile, art, story by: Iridescent
